The VI1000 is a portable multi-parameter water quality analyzer elaborately designed by VVNA Micro-Nano Technology, built on years of technical accumulation. Compact and lightweight in design, it is easy to carry and suitable for both laboratory use and operation under harsh outdoor conditions. Equipped with built-in standard analysis programs, it supports the measurement of multiple parameters including turbidity, colority, free chlorine residual, total chlorine, pH, dissolved oxygen, permanganate index, ammonia, and COD. Widely used in fields such as municipal sewage treatment, environmental monitoring, water treatment, industrial process monitoring, tap water supply, drinking water, boiler water, cooling water, education, and agriculture, it is an ideal tool for water quality monitoring across various industries.
